even if you have never done it before you dont have to worry, its simple, all you do is take the light out which requires unplugging a few wires and latched, then you heat it up like in an oven and basically pull it apart, then the reflector just snaps out, then you reglue it, put it back together and put some rubber bands around it to hold it together while it dries, then you hook it back up and you're done :thumbsup:
